The IHS Primary Care Provider is a monthly publication of the Indian Health Service (IHS) Clinical Support Center. It is distributed to approximately 8000 health care providers working for IHS, urban Indian, and tribal health programs; in addition, it is sent to medical, nursing, and pharmacy schools throughout the country.

The goal of The Provider (as it is commonly referred to) is communication. It targets health care professionals including, among others, physicians, nurses, pharmacists, dentists, and dietitians. The editors welcome articles, letters, commentaries, and editorials that would be of interest to all those who provide health care to American Indians and Alaska Natives.
